The zār in Sudan very likely has not been homogeneous,[39] and El Hadidi emphasizes the adaptable mother nature of zār across Africa in her own composing.

The bowl is uncovered. The brigdar opens the sheep's mouth using a knife, then pours milk in it, a symbolic consummation of the wedding among newbie and spirit. The brigdar cuts some tongue parts and throws them in direction of the flags. He is additionally purported to ask for the bride taste a bit of tongue. The sanjak plays khayt tracks. The bowl is place around the bride's knees, then returned to mat. The beginner dances, and then the jalīsa brings them a coffee and tea combination to consume. The rabāba, hārasān, drums, and flags are anointed with coffee. The sanjak repeats tahlīl, and following the brigdar requires a crack. The bride is returned to the tumbura place, and everybody else dances.[a hundred and eighty]

When the ritual is for zār infidel spirit, not one person is permitted to mention God, Muhammad, or maybe the 14 holy people, or else the spirit will never be placated. If immediately after making an attempt numerous situations For a lot of times, the spirit cannot be placated, the Bābās and Māmās will stop to operate Along with the affected person and they're going to be considered tahrans, an outcast and hated standing.[ten]

[one zero five] This point out makes it possible for the shaykha to diagnose, plus the ailment may not necessarily be possession. Magic and also the evil eye could also tumble underneath the shaykha's capability to treat, commonly with incense, counter get the job done with roots, and published spells or charms hidden in the affected individual's property. Even so the claimed power to take care of these, which fall exterior the realm of zār, could possibly be merely a strategy for emphasizing a shaykha's electric power, instead of completed in apply.[106] The shaykha frequently deals with issues from the private sphere, for example managing people, day-to-working day operating on the group, and ceremonies celebrated by unique devotees. She is chargeable for the costumes and objects on the spirit, the purchase by which tracks are sung, and which incense ought to be used.[162]

Procedure involves negotiating While using the spirit and is taken into account prosperous Should the affected individual feels reduction right after trance. When the title is revealed, the health care provider asks what would please the spirit, and it'll title some things and an animal. These will likely be procured (They may be known as the enjoy gift to the zar, maqwadasha) plus the animal is sacrificed. The affected individual eats many of the meat.

Following the recitation of tatrīq, the very best ranking shaykha and brigdar established the bowl of asīda to the "bride's" head. The brigdar usually takes some asīda on his appropriate forefinger and smears it to the 'idda seven situations. The bowl is then place within the bride's knees, and also the shaykha reaches under the tob to provide them with 3 mouthfuls to eat. She pours tea and occasional into one particular cup to the bride to drink. The pigeons at the moment are brought out. 1 is rubbed to the bride's head and established free- it takes the ailment away, and whoever catches It will likely be Blessed.

Bābās and Māmās concentrate on which spirits they can deal with- when they locate the person is possessed by a spirit they cannot handle, they suggest a Bābā or Māmā that can handle the spirit.[three] If normal Bābās and Māmās are unsuccessful, They might send out the person into a gaptaran, the most powerful Bābā or Māmā in a very region.

Just about every music possesses its have rhythm and is sung to a unique spirit. Although the Zar gatherings act as an important sort of expression for Ladies in conservative, strictly patriarchal rural communities, according to the folk music skilled Zakaria Ibrahim.

Upon confirmation from the zār spirit's involvement, the individual decides if to carry on with treatment. They typically do, although they typically also focus on it with their family. The family pays the shaykha and provides her 10 ratls of sugar, one 1/two a ratl of coffee and tea Every, three packs of cigarettes, 3 packs of matches, 7 candles, 3 sorts of sweets, one bottle of Bint al-Sudan, and 1 bottle of sandaliyya perfume. These are typically "the points to the incense" (al-hāyāt lil-bakhūr). They are also generally brought as items at births, circumcisions, and weddings. The patient stays during the tumbura home for 7 days, throughout musical bag which They are really regarded as the two dangerous and particularly susceptible to jinn, evil eye, and sorcery. As such, The full approach is private, without massive gatherings. Just the shaykha and jalīsa are to enter the tumbura area and care for the patients.
